微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

将网站访问者重定向到Nginx中的Bowser语言URL重写

如何解决将网站访问者重定向到Nginx中的Bowser语言URL重写

问候大家!

我正在努力将Nginx中的网站访问者重定向到Bowser语言到他们的浏览器语言,我正在尝试使用url重写规则在Nginx上进行此操作,

我已经用Google搜索并尝试了其他选项,但是我什么也没找到。

我的网站有4种或5种语言,但是认情况下必须设置一种,因此无法禁用它,因此我的目的是将网站的认语言重定向到访问者浏览器的认语言。

示例:

https://mywebsite.com/认网址将显示认语言),但是如果选择网站上英语语言的英语访问者访问了该网站,则主网址将更改为

  1. 英语访问者https://mywebsite.com/?language=english
  2. 西班牙游客https://mywebsite.com/?language=spanish
  3. 法国访客https://mywebsite.com/?language=french

那么你们为Nginx重写规则推荐什么代码?我正在努力避免弄乱index.PHP,但在最后一种情况下是有可能的。

如果你们能提供帮助,我将不胜感激,我不是Nginx规则或PHP方面的专家。

谢谢

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。